What Features Should You Consider When Choosing a Consumer Lawn Mower?

When choosing the best consumer lawn mower, several important features should be taken into account:

  • Cutting Width: The cutting width determines how much grass the mower can cut in a single pass. A wider cutting deck can reduce mowing time, making it ideal for larger lawns, while a narrower deck may be more suitable for smaller, intricate areas.
  • Power Source: Lawn mowers can be powered by gas, electricity, or batteries. Gas mowers tend to have more power and are good for larger lawns, while electric mowers are quieter and require less maintenance, making them perfect for smaller yards.
  • Self-Propelled vs. Push: Self-propelled mowers make mowing easier as they move on their own, which is beneficial for hilly or large lawns. Push mowers require more physical effort but are often lighter and simpler to operate.
  • Cutting Height Adjustment: This feature allows you to easily modify the height at which the mower cuts grass. Being able to adjust the cutting height is important for maintaining a healthy lawn, as different grass types may require different cutting lengths.
  • Mulching Capability: Some mowers offer a mulching function that finely chops grass clippings and returns them to the lawn as natural fertilizer. This can help improve soil health and reduce waste, making it an environmentally friendly option.
  • Weight and Maneuverability: The weight of the mower affects how easy it is to push and maneuver, especially in tight spaces. Lighter mowers are generally easier to handle, while heavier models may provide better stability and cutting performance.
  • Grass Bagging System: Having a grass bagging option allows for easy collection of clippings, which is especially useful for maintaining a tidy lawn. Some mowers feature a side discharge or rear bagging option, offering flexibility depending on the mowing conditions.
  • Durability and Build Quality: The materials and construction of a mower impact its longevity and performance. Look for mowers made with high-quality materials that can withstand regular use and various weather conditions.
  • Noise Level: Noise levels can vary significantly among different mowers, especially between gas and electric models. If you live in a community with noise restrictions, an electric mower may be a quieter and more considerate choice.

What Types of Lawn Mowers Are Available for Consumers?

There are several types of lawn mowers available for consumers, each designed to meet specific needs and preferences.

  • Push Mowers: These are manually operated mowers that require the user to push them across the lawn. They are ideal for small to medium-sized yards and are environmentally friendly since they do not require fuel or electricity.
  • Self-Propelled Mowers: These mowers come with a drive system that propels the mower forward, reducing the effort needed from the user. They are great for larger lawns and hilly terrains, as they offer better maneuverability and require less physical exertion.
  • Riding Mowers: Designed for larger properties, riding mowers allow the operator to sit while mowing, making them more comfortable for extensive lawn care tasks. They often come with additional features such as attachments for mulching and bagging grass clippings.
  • Zero-Turn Mowers: These mowers feature a unique turning radius that allows them to maneuver around obstacles with ease. Their efficient design makes them a popular choice for homeowners with intricate landscapes or larger lawns needing quick and precise mowing.
  • Electric Mowers: Available in both corded and battery-powered versions, electric mowers are quieter and produce no emissions, making them an eco-friendly option. They are best suited for smaller yards due to their limited range and power compared to gas mowers.
  • Robotic Mowers: These high-tech devices can autonomously mow the lawn with minimal human intervention. They are programmed to navigate the yard and can be scheduled for regular mowing, making them a convenient choice for busy homeowners.

What Maintenance Tips Are Essential for Keeping Your Lawn Mower in Top Shape?

Essential maintenance tips for keeping your lawn mower in top shape include:

  • Regular Blade Sharpening: Keeping the blades sharp ensures a clean cut, which is vital for a healthy lawn. Dull blades can tear the grass, leading to an unhealthy appearance and making the lawn more susceptible to disease.
  • Oil Changes: Just like a car, your lawn mower requires regular oil changes to maintain engine performance. Old oil can become contaminated and less effective, so changing it at least once a season is crucial for longevity.
  • Air Filter Cleaning/Replacement: A clean air filter allows for optimal air flow to the engine, enhancing efficiency and performance. Regularly checking and replacing the air filter can prevent engine damage and improve fuel efficiency.
  • Fuel Stabilization: If you don’t use your mower frequently, adding a fuel stabilizer can prevent the gasoline from breaking down and causing engine issues. This is particularly important if you store your mower during the off-season.
  • Clean the Undercarriage: Debris build-up under the mower deck can affect cutting performance and lead to rust. Regularly cleaning the undercarriage helps maintain optimal cutting efficiency and extends the life of your mower.
  • Check Spark Plug Condition: The spark plug is crucial for starting the engine and ensuring it runs smoothly. Inspecting and replacing a worn or dirty spark plug can improve starting and overall engine performance.
  • Tire Maintenance: Properly inflated tires ensure even cutting and better maneuverability. Regularly checking tire pressure and condition can prevent uneven wear and improve handling on various terrains.
  • Inspect Cables and Belts: Over time, cables and belts can wear out or become frayed, leading to operational issues. Regularly inspecting and replacing these components when necessary can prevent unexpected breakdowns.
